The Gambler is a gripping novel by Fyodor Dostoevsky, exploring the depths of human psychology and the allure of risk and addiction. Set in a fictional German spa town, the story follows Alexei Ivanovich, a young tutor who becomes embroiled in the world of gambling. As he recklessly plunges into the thrill of the game, Alexei's life spirals out of control, leading to financial ruin and emotional turmoil. Alongside him are a cast of characters including the beautiful Polina and the enigmatic General, each with their own motivations and desires. Dostoevsky's masterful portrayal of obsession, greed, and desperation delves into the darker aspects of the human psyche, revealing the destructive consequences of unchecked impulses. Through vivid prose and psychological depth, The Gambler remains a timeless exploration of addiction and the complex interplay between fate and free will, leaving readers captivated by its raw intensity and profound insights.
